One of the characteristics that distinguish conservative, liberal and radical philosophies is their opinion on political reform.

Conservatives, as the name indicates, want to "conserve" traditions and institutions. They believe that change should be slow, and that institutions that have traditionally worked have extra value because of their longevity.

Liberals, on the other hand, believe in the idea of progress and self-improvement. They believe that, if an institution is not efficient enough, society benefits from replacing it. They also defend the freedom of individuals to push for change, even if it goes against social institutions and traditions.

Finally, radicals favor extreme and deep reform. They see little value in tradition, and believe that extreme change is the only answer for problems that run deep or are particularly pervasive.
